About

Laurie Rene Perozzo Farshad is a child support attorney with 16 years of legal experience, practicing at The Law Office of Laurie Perozzo, P.L.L.C. in Beaumont, TX. She attended Thurgood Marshall School of Law. She has been admitted to the Texas Bar since 2009. Her practice encompasses child support, criminal defense, estate planning, and personal injury, allowing her to serve clients across a range of legal needs. In addition to English, she is proficient in Farsi, French, Persian, and Spanish. She ma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
